20-Year-Old Woman Arrested for Murder Outside San Jose Nightclub

San Francisco, CALocal News

The San Jose Police Department arrested 20-year-old Mercedes Rosales for the murder of Raymond Orozco, 22, who was fatally stabbed outside a downtown nightclub on July 20. Orozco reportedly intervened in a fight involving one of his female friends, which led to the deadly confrontation. Authorities believe Rosales was the one who wielded the knife, while 18-year-old Micaela Van has been arrested on suspicion of being an accessory to murder. The motive behind the scuffle remains unclear, and no formal charges have been filed against the women. Orozco's family described him as a peacemaker who was trying to protect his friends during the incident.

They have made a public plea for witnesses to come forward, especially those who recorded the fight on their cellphones. A GoFundMe campaign for Orozco's funeral expenses is still short of its $26,000 goal. Orozco worked as a manager at group homes for seniors and had recently been accepted into a fire academy program.
